About Accomplish Health
Accomplish Health is the industry leader in telehealth obesity care, redefining remote medical weight management and medical bariatrics. We provide evidence-based, stigma-free care managed by obesity-specialized physicians and dietitians. Our mission is to help patients achieve sustainable metabolic health, weight loss, and overall wellness.
Our virtual care model integrates pharmacotherapy, nutrition therapy, health coaching, and connected devices to deliver accessible, measurable, and sustainable outcomes.
About the Position
We're looking for a Patient Care Manager to lead and develop our front-line team dedicated to supporting patients. In this pivotal role, you'll ensure every patient interaction—whether by phone, portal, scheduling system, or virtual visit—is handled with excellence, timeliness, and empathy. Reporting directly to the Head of Operations, you'll be instrumental in shaping the patient experience from first contact through ongoing care.
As Patient Care Manager, you'll guide a team of front desk specialists while collaborating with leadership to maintain service excellence, implement process enhancements that improve patient readiness and operational efficiency, and leverage data insights to drive strategic improvements. This is a full-time, remote position.
What You'll Do
Lead Patient Care Coordination
Direct daily patient-facing operations including inbound/outbound calls, voicemail management, appointment scheduling and adjustments, patient portal communications, and virtual visit support
Maintain adherence to service level agreements, performance metrics, and quality standards across all patient touchpoints
Resolve patient access barriers and service issues, escalating complex situations according to established protocols
Ensure thoroughness and accuracy in documentation, task completion, and data entry throughout patient care workflows
Build and Develop Your Team
Lead and mentor Patient Care Coordinators (PCC) in a remote work environment through regular coaching, feedback, and performance development
Conduct ongoing one-on-one meetings focused on service quality, response times, and patient experience outcomes
Foster a culture of accountability, continuous improvement, and patient-centered service
Optimize Systems and Processes
Manage omnichannel communication tools and operational platforms (phone systems, patient portals, EMR, scheduling software) to support seamless patient care delivery
Identify inefficiencies in workflows, handoff procedures, and recurring service gaps, bringing forward actionable recommendations to leadership
Contribute to process documentation and improvement initiatives that enhance service delivery
Partner Across Functions
Collaborate with Clinical teams, Registered Dietitians, and Care Teams to ensure coordinated patient communications and scheduling
Work with B2B partners to facilitate referral intake processes and patient communication workflows
What We're Looking For
Experience & Education
Bachelor's degree or equivalent hands-on operational experience
Proven track record managing patient access, front desk, intake, or patient support teams in healthcare or telehealth settings
Deep familiarity with patient-facing workflows and service delivery standards
Skills & Capabilities
Track record of driving process improvements—documenting workflows, developing process maps, and identifying enhancement opportunities in collaboration with leadership
Strong ability to coach, develop, and support remote team members effectively
Proficiency with healthcare technology platforms including EMRs, scheduling systems, phone platforms, and operational dashboards
Exceptional organizational abilities with keen attention to detail
Strong technical aptitude and data-driven approach, comfortable analyzing metrics and adapting to evolving custom-built systems, EHRs, and communication tools (Slack, Google Workspace, etc.)
Excellent written and verbal communication skills with the ability to support team members and partner effectively across departments
Success Metrics
Your performance will be evaluated based on:
Achievement of key operational metrics (call volume, portal response times, voicemail handling, internal task completion)
Timeliness and accuracy of scheduling and patient communications
Patient satisfaction scores and experience indicators
Team service quality, consistency, and responsiveness
Proper escalation of issues following established protocols
